The Chevrolet Monte Carlo commonly fits stock sizes like 225/60-16 and 245/50-17. For those seeking larger, more rugged options, the 255/75-17 size is popular for off-road and aftermarket upgrades. Always consult with Able Tire and Brake experts to ensure the best fit for your specific model.

While you can replace a single tire, it’s generally recommended to replace tires in pairs or all four to maintain balanced tread and handling, especially for vehicles like the Chevrolet Monte Carlo. This helps preserve traction and safety. Able Tire and Brake can help you assess your tires and offer advice, plus schedule a same-day appointment for fast service.

Tire life for a Chevrolet Monte Carlo usually ranges between 40,000 to 60,000 miles, depending on tire type, driving habits, and road conditions. Off-road tires might wear differently than street tires. Check out tire warranty information or consult Able Tire and Brake for guidance on maximizing your tire’s lifespan.
